How much do video codec engineer jobs pay per year?

As of Jun 1, 2026, the average yearly pay for video codec engineer in the United States is $88,303.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$65,000.00 and $108,500.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What does a Video Codec Engineer do?

A Video Codec Engineer specializes in developing, optimizing, and implementing video compression and decompression algorithms. They work with codecs like H.264, H.265, AV1, and VP9 to improve video quality, reduce file sizes, and enhance streaming efficiency. Their responsibilities include performance tuning, codec integration, and hardware/software acceleration. They often collaborate with software developers, researchers, and hardware engineers to ensure efficient video delivery across different platforms and devices.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ive in the Video Codec Engineer position,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Video Codec Engineer, you need a strong background in computer science, digital signal processing, and video/audio compression standards, often supported by a relevant bachelor's or master's degree. Familiarity with programming languages such as C/C++, codec libraries (like H.264/HEVC/AV1), and tools like FFmpeg or GStreamer is essential. Strong problem-solving, communication, and teamwork skills help you collaborate effectively and adapt to evolving technical requirements. These skills ensure you can design, optimize, and maintain efficient codec solutions that meet industry performance and compatibility standards.

What are typical daily responsibilities for a Video Codec Engineer?

As a Video Codec Engineer, your daily responsibilities typically include designing and optimizing video compression algorithms, integrating codec solutions into multimedia applications, and troubleshooting encoding/decoding issues. You may work closely with software developers, QA engineers, and hardware teams to ensure smooth performance and compatibility across platforms. Regular tasks also involve analyzing video quality, conducting performance benchmarks, and keeping up to date with the latest codec standards. This collaborative and technical environment offers opportunities to work on cutting-edge projects and contribute to innovations in streaming technology.

Responsibilities

  • Lead a team of Associate Consultants on client projects involving video compression and video delivery technologies.

  • Own delivery of patent analysis and IP monetization research related to video codecs and video processing, including technology due diligence, claim charting/infringement analysis, prior art searching, market research, and target scouting.

  • Analyze, reverse engineer, and test implementations of video codecs and related pipelines (e.g., AV1, HEVC, HDR workflows) using industry-standard tools and/or custom-built tools.

  • Design and execute test benches to evaluate codec behavior, compression efficiency, rate–distortion performance, and standards compliance.

  • Review specifications and reference software for video coding standards (e.g., AV1, H.264/AVC, H.265/HEVC, VVC) and map technical details to patent claims and accused products.

  • Support Expert Witnesses and attorneys on IP litigation matters, including technical analysis for reports, source code review, and preparation for depositions, hearings, and trial.

  • Establish and cultivate relationships with existing and prospective clients, and serve as a subject-matter advocate for Lumenci’s video/media technology capabilities.

  • Identify and develop relationships with specialized labs or partners for video codec product testing and reverse engineering services.

  • Collaborate with Lumenci’s product teams to advise on requirements, testing, and roadmap for technology platforms related to video analysis, reverse engineering, and IP analytics.

  • Showcase thought leadership in video compression and IP (e.g., blogs, whitepapers, research summaries, internal training).

  • Collaborate across the organization with in-person and distributed global teams; attend internal and external meetings, workshops, conferences, source code reviews, depositions, and trials as needed.

Minimum Requirements

  • Bachelor’s degree in Electrical Engineering, Computer Science, or a closely related field.

  • 3–5 years of hands-on experience working with modern video codecs in an R&D, engineering, standards, or video quality role (e.g., AV1, HEVC/H.265, VVC, VP9), including implementing, integrating, or optimizing codecs.

  • Strong understanding of video compression fundamentals (e.g., motion estimation, transform coding, prediction, rate control, entropy coding) and HDR video concepts (e.g., PQ/HLG, color spaces, tone mapping).

  • Experience reading and working from codec specifications or reference implementations for one or more standards (such as AV1, H.264/AVC, H.265/HEVC, VVC).

  • Demonstrated proficiency in one or more relevant programming/scripting languages (e.g., C/C++, Python, MATLAB) for building tools, automating tests, or analyzing codec behavior.

  • Ability to clearly explain complex technical topics in writing and verbally to both technical and non-technical audiences.

  • Strong analytical skills, attention to detail, and the ability to manage multiple projects and deadlines.

  • Approximately 40% domestic travel (for client meetings, expert meetings, source code reviews, depositions/trials, conferences).

  • Work-from-home flexibility.

Preferred Qualifications

  • Experience supporting IP litigation, licensing, standards‑essential patent work, or patent monetization related to video compression or media technologies.

  • Familiarity with common tools and workflows for video quality assessment, bitstream analysis, and debugging (e.g., ffmpeg, VMAF/PSNR/SSIM workflows, codec test models).

  • Experience interacting with standardization activities or patent pools related to video codecs (e.g., MPEG, AOMedia, patent pools for HEVC/AV1).

  • Prior work with HDR pipelines (capture, processing, and display), color management, and media delivery (e.g., HLS/DASH).
